The Great Divide Color Club swatch


Is crackle polish still a trendy thing?
Ah well, I never was a trendy person. I found this great looking crackle at Meijer called The Great Divide. It’s a beautiful color, and I actually wish it wasn’t a top coat but an actual color, I’d wear it out. When I first saw it, it reminded me of Glitter Gal Lizard Belly but it’s not a holo polish. It’s a blue/green/teal jelly-ish polish that is loaded with gold and blue micro shimmer glitter. This is my first encounter with Color Club polish and I’m pretty sure I’ll be going back for more. The base coat is Sally Hansen Insta-Dri in Lickety-Split Lime.
